Transaction 43adb2933c42b86807c50d8d9f998fc805d99bfecf69c14ff9d4195c47bb6a09
2 Input
2 Outputs
- 43adb2933c42b86807c50d8d9f998fc805d99bfecf69c14ff9d4195c47bb6a09:0
- 43adb2933c42b86807c50d8d9f998fc805d99bfecf69c14ff9d4195c47bb6a09:1
value 80000
address 2MwHKm3ZSbpTwRU2gQ3XhdPTPv279SkJhue
value 52876
address mpd8wL8fY83uWX6pcmQx1SgVrHjezLmU6W